Description
South Park Volume 5 Conjoined Fetus Lady The dodgeball team, with star player Pip, is off to the championships. Back In town, local citizens help the school nurse deal with her strange medical disorder. The Mexican Staring Frog of Southern Sri Lanka Ned and Jimbo track the deadly Mexican Staring Frog, and the success of their new cable-access hunting show threatens to edge out an old favorite, ?Jesus and Pals.? Flashbacks As their school bus teeters on a cliff?s edge, the boys relive landmark moments from their youth. When Ms. Crabtree goes for help, she finds?love! Summer Sucks Fireworks are banned, Mr. Hat forced to take swimming lessons. Plus, the mayor?s plan to put some punch in the July 4th celebration goes awry.

3 out of 5 stars Quick Ned, THIN OUT THEIR NUMBERS!.......2001-02-04

This volume of South Park episodes is structurally identical to all six volumes that have been released so far, and suffers from the same shortcomings. One glaring flaw is that none of the episodes are sub-titled, so if you are hearing impaired, you're out of luck.

I don't find these episodes as funny as the first time I watched them. A lot of the humor of South Park is in shock value, and that has worn off. But even so, I find them funny enough to be worth watching every now and then. If you are a hard core fan, I recommend you drop thirteen bucks for the DVD. If you are just a casual fan, your money would be better spent elsewhere.

There are no extras on the DVD to make it really stand out from the VHS version. The primary advantage of the DVD is random access to the episodes. You also get Matt and Trey introducing the episodes, which is fairly amusing. However, the lack of substantive extras is very disappointing. Also, the menus are static and silent; the power of the DVD medium has been completely ignored. This is why I only give this DVD 3 stars.

Some have complained that you can't skip the introductions, but I have no problem fast forwarding through them with my DVD player. Many have also complained about the three worthless items appearing at the end of each episode (the Braniff logo, Comedy Central logo, and FBI warnings). But simply pressing the "menu" button on your DVD's remote is all that is required to skip these items. I don't like this rubbish either, but the people who whine on incessantly about this are making a mountain out of a molehill.

So sit back, relax, and enjoy the show!
